"A
VISIT TO THE OPTICIAN"
TEXT: REVELATION 3:14-22
INTRODUCTION:
Here we have a picture of the final church age just in the end-time.
NOTICE:
I. THE CHARGE NEITHER COLD NOR HOT.
I I. THE CLAIM- VERSE # 17
III. THE COUNSEL VERSE # 18
The outstanding claim here is that "I have need of nothing", the
outstanding charge is: "Thou art blind" , and the outstanding
challenge is "Anoint thine eyes with eyesalve that thou mayest see.
"Every preacher has about the same claim for the church, "We're
doing o.k. we have good offerings, no discord, no indifference etc. , Most of
them know it's a lie but they don't want to recognize their trouble.
NOTICE:
I. THE OBSTRUCTIONS. "THOU ART
BLIND"
- Sin obstructs spiritual vision.
- Self obstructs spiritual vision.
- Satan obstructs spiritual vision.
- Society obstructs spiritual vision.
II. NOTICE THE OPTICIAN "JESUS
CHRIST"
- HE knows the need
- HE makes the diagnosis
- HE can give the correct lenses
III. THE OINTMENT EYESALVE
A. This eyesalve will help us observe the will of the FATHER.
B. This eyesalve will give us the Eyes of the HOLY SPIRIT.
C. This eyesalve will let us see the need of the world as the son saw it.
As long as a person cannot see the rut that they are in, they will never
see the need of getting out or seeking THE WAY out.
